Disclosure portal
FAO discloses project documents and environmental and social risk management plans on this disclosure portal as part of its efforts to be transparent to stakeholders and provide them with opportunities to engage in FAO’s work. Based on requirements set out in its Framework for Environmental and Social Management, FAO aims to make project-level information related to environmental and social risk management available in a timely manner. Documents are disclosed once final, and before the start of the implementation of the project.
Do you have a feedback or grievance about an FAO project? Use the project-specific Grievance Redress Mechanism, or the country-level Grievance Redress Mechanism (please check the FAO country profile for available channels).
If a grievance cannot be resolved through project management or technical level, or if the grievance is related to misconduct (such as fraud, corruption, sexual exploitation and abuse), you should contact the Office of the Inspector General (Investigations).
